Abstract

Official abstract text for this publication.

The present disclosure relates to an organic electroluminescent compound, a plurality of host materials, and an organic electroluminescent device comprising the same. By comprising the organic electroluminescent compound according to the present disclosure, an organic electroluminescent device having long lifespan properties could be prepared, and by comprising a plurality of host materials according to the present disclosure, an organic electroluminescent device having long lifespan properties could be prepared.

First claim

Opening claim text (preview).

1 . A plurality of host materials comprising: a first host material comprising a compound represented by the following formula 1: wherein, X 1 and Y 1 each independently represent, —N═, —NR 5 , —O—, or —S—, provided that any one of X 1 and Y 1 is —N═ and the other of X 1 and Y 1 is —NR 5 —, —O—, or —S—; R 1 represents a substituted or unsubstituted (C6-C30)aryl, a substituted or unsubstituted (3- to 30-membered)heteroaryl, or the following formula 1-a: wherein, L 1 represents a single bond, a substituted or unsubstituted (C6-C30)arylene, or a substituted or unsubstituted (3- to 30-membered)heteroarylene; Ar 1 represents a substituted or unsubstituted (C6-C30)aryl or a substituted or unsubstituted (3- to 30-membered)heteroaryl; Ar 2 represents a substituted or unsubstituted (3- to 30-membered)heteroaryl; and R 6 each independently represents, hydrogen, deuterium, halogen, cyano, a substituted or unsubstituted (C1-C30)alkyl, a substituted or unsubstituted (C6-C30)aryl, a substituted or unsubstituted (3- to 30-membered)heteroaryl, a substituted or unsubstituted (C3-C30)cycloalkyl, a substituted or unsubstituted (C1-C30)alkoxy, a substituted or unsubstituted tri(C1-C30)alkylsilyl, a substituted or unsubstituted di(C1-C30)alkyl(C6-C30)arylsilyl, a substituted or unsubstituted (C1-C30)alkyldi(C6-C30)arylsilyl, a substituted or unsubstituted tri(C6-C30)arylsilyl, a substituted or unsubstituted fused ring of a (C3-C30)aliphatic ring and a (C6-C30)aromatic ring, a substituted or unsubstituted mono- or di-(C1-C30)alkylamino, a substituted or unsubstituted mono- or di-(C6-C30)arylamino, a substituted or unsubstituted (C1-C30)alkyl(C6-C30)arylamino, a substituted or unsubstituted mono- or di-(3- to 30-membered)heteroarylamino, or a substituted or unsubstituted (C6-C30)aryl(3- to 30-membered)heteroarylamino; or may be linked to an adjacent substituent to form a ring; R 2 to R 5 each independently represent, hydrogen, deuterium, halogen, cyano, a substituted or unsubstituted (C1-C30)alkyl, a substituted or unsubstituted (C6-C30)aryl, a substituted or unsubstituted (3- to 30-membered)heteroaryl, a substituted or unsubstituted (C3-C30)cycloalkyl, a substituted or unsubstituted (C1-C30)alkoxy, a substituted or unsubstituted tri(C1-C30)alkylsilyl, a substituted or unsubstituted di(C1-C30)alkyl(C6-C30)arylsilyl, a substituted or unsubstituted (C1-C30)alkyldi(C6-C30)arylsilyl, a substituted or unsubstituted tri(C6-C30)arylsilyl, a substituted or unsubstituted fused ring of a (C3-C30)aliphatic ring and a (C6-C30)aromatic ring, or the formula 1-a; or may be linked to an adjacent substituent to form a ring, provided that at least one of R 1 to R 5 is represented by the formula 1-a; a and b each independently represent an integer of 1 or 2, and c and d each independently represent an integer of 1 to 4; and when a to d are an integer of 2 or more, each of R 2 to R 4 , and each of R 6 may be the same or different, and a second host material comprising a compound represented by the following formula 2: wherein, X 2 is —O— or —S—; Ring A is a benzene ring or a naphthalene ring; R 21 and R 22 each independently represent hydrogen, deuterium, halogen, cyano, a substituted or unsubstituted (C1-C30)alkyl, a substituted or unsubstituted (C6-C30)aryl, a substituted or unsubstituted (3- to 30-membered)heteroaryl, a substituted or unsubstituted (C3-C30)cycloalkyl, a substituted or unsubstituted (C1-C30)alkoxy, a substituted or unsubstituted tri(C1-C30)alkylsilyl, a substituted or unsubstituted di(C1-C30)alkyl(C6-C30)arylsilyl, a substituted or unsubstituted (C1-C30)alkyldi(C6-C30)arylsilyl, or a substituted or unsubstituted tri(C6-C30)arylsilyl, or may be linked to an adjacent substituent to form a ring; L 2 represents a single bond, a substituted or unsubstituted (C6-C30)arylene, or a substituted or unsubstituted (3- to 30-membered)heteroarylene; HAr represents a substituted or unsubstituted (3- to 30-membered)heteroaryl containing at least one nitrogen atom; n is an integer of 1 to 5, and m is an integer of 1 to 4; and when n and m are an integer of 2 or more, each of R 21 and each of R 22 may be the same or different. 2 . The plurality of host materials according to claim 1 , wherein the substituted alkyl, the substituted aryl(ene), the substituted heteroaryl, the substituted cycloalkyl, the substituted alkoxy, the substituted trialkylsilyl, the substituted dialkylarylsilyl, the substituted alkyldiarylsilyl, the substituted triarylsilyl, the fused ring of substituted aliphatic ring and aromatic ring, the substituted mono- or di-alkylamino, the substituted mono- or di-arylamino, the substituted alkylarylamino, the substituted mono- or di-heteroarylamino, and the substituted arylheteroarylamino are each independently substituted with one or more selected from the group consisting of deuterium, halogen, cyano, carboxyl, nitro, hydroxy, (C1-C30)alkyl, halo(C1-C30)alkyl, (C2-C30)alkenyl, (C2-C30)alkynyl, (C1-C30)alkoxy, (C1-C30)alkylthio, (C3-C30)cycloalkyl, (C3-C30)cycloalkenyl, (3- to 7-membered)heterocycloalkyl, (C6-C30)aryloxy, (C6-C30)arylthio, (5- to 30-membered)heteroaryl substituted or unsubstituted with (C6-C30)aryl, (C6-C30)aryl substituted or unsubstituted with (5- to 30-membered)heteroaryl, tri(C1-C30)alkylsilyl, tri(C6-C30)arylsilyl, di(C1-C30)alkyl(C6-C30)arylsilyl, (C1-C30)alkyldi(C6-C30)arylsilyl, a fused ring of a (C3-C30)aliphatic ring and a (C6-C30)aromatic ring, amino, mono- or di-(C1-C30)alkylamino, substituted or unsubstituted mono- or di-(C6-C30)arylamino, (C1-C30)alkyl(C6-C30)arylamino, mono- or di-(3- to 30-membered)heteroarylamino, (C1-C30)alkyl(3- to 30-membered)heteroarylamino, (C6-C30)aryl(3- to 30-membered)heteroarylamino, (C1-C30)alkylcarbonyl, (C1-C30)alkoxycarbonyl, (C6-C30)arylcarbonyl, (C6-C30)arylphosphinyl, di(C6-C30)arylboronyl, di(C1-C30)alkylboronyl, (C1-C30)alkyl(C6-C30)arylboronyl, (C6-C30)ar(C1-C30)alkyl, and (C1-C30)alkyl(C6-C30)aryl. 3 . The plurality of host materials according to claim 1 , wherein the formula 1 is represented by any one of the following formulas 1-1 to 1-4: wherein, c′ is an integer of 1 to 3; when c′ is an integer of 2 or more, each of R 4 may be the same or different; and X 1 , Y 1 , R 1 to R 4 , R 6 , L 1 , Ar 1 , Ar 2 , and a to d are the same as defined in claim 1 . 4 . The plurality of host materials according to claim 1 , wherein Ar 2 of the formula 1-a represents any one of following formulas R-1 to R-4: wherein, X is O, S, Se, or N; and R 11 to R 18 may each independently represent, hydrogen, deuterium, a substituted or unsubstituted (C1-C30)alkyl, or a substituted or unsubstituted (C6-C30)aryl. 5 .
